As a Freelance Travel Planner, you will be responsible for crafting personalized travel experiences for clients, from initial inquiry to post-trip follow-up.

You'll be working closely with our clients, vendors, and internal team to create tailored itineraries and ensure exceptional customer satisfaction.

This is a remote, freelance position, allowing you to work from the comfort of your own location with flexible hours.


Key Responsibilities:
  • Communicate with clients to understand their travel preferences, requirements, and budget constraints.
  • Create customized travel itineraries that cater to individual tastes and preferences, including flights, accommodations, transportation, activities, and excursions.
  • Source with vendors, airlines, hotels, and local guides to secure the best possible rates and experiences for clients.
  • Manage travel bookings and reservations efficiently, ensuring all logistics are in place and properly documented.
  • Handle any modifications or changes to travel plans promptly and efficiently.
  • Provide timely and accurate travel information, including visa requirements, safety tips, and cultural insights.
  • Maintain up-to-date knowledge of travel trends, destinations, and industry developments.
  • Handle post-travel follow-up to gather feedback from clients and ensure their satisfaction.

Requirements:
  • Previous experience as a Travel Coordinator, Travel Agent, or a related role is preferred.
  • Passion for travel and a deep understanding of various travel destinations and cultures.
  • Exceptional organizational skills and attention to detail.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al abilities, with a customer-centric approach.
  • Ability to work independently and efficiently in a remote, freelance environment.
  • Proficiency in using travel booking platforms and related software.
  • Flexibility to accommodate different time zones and varying workloads.
  • Problem-solving skills and the ability to handle unexpected situations calmly and effectively.
  • Knowledge of multiple languages is a plus, but not required.
